  13. I rewatched Otonal after watching Chen's SP (sorryyyy), I actually like the uneven choreography of the program. The first calm part with less movement is important in terms of introducing or inviting audience into the storytelling. The second part with tense music and bodily movement let the program reach to its peak. The arrangement of the pace is smart. I don't think a good performance means you need fill out the whole program with complex footwork from the beginning to the end. That would be disaster since it is not a story, lacks of theatric narrative, no distinction between interlude and culmination, in other words, tedious for sure. So I am glad to see Yuzu's movement arrangement is perfectly artistic. BUT there are indeed some moments, may a few seconds, I think can add to more details like the spread eagle pass through the Juges can be added with some arm movements. And the entry into the second part the crossig through the whole ice rink can also have more complex trajactory. I just envision a more detailed program would be presented in future competition.

  19. I think the point is not whether you choose the music from your own cultural background, but rather whether you personally have certain connection with the music per se. The music resonates with you in certain way, and in turn you bring out that affection and understanding. When you have that feeling you would be released from the mechanic enactment abided to principal, internalizing the rhythm and melody in your body movement. The music as outside thing becomes one with you. That's the idea of Zen philosophy.
